		<description><![CDATA[Teams will not be able to contact players once they draft them.   No advance prep, playbook study, or mentoring from current NFL players for these players thus making the jump the NFL a more daunting proposition.    If the lockout goes long, it will be interesting to see if a greater percentage of 2011 draft picks get released before this season or next. 

It simply may be a matter of teams needing more veterans who know the NFL system.  If the lockout ends in September, there is no way that some of the kids will be ready for the NFL with a couple weeks practice.  Compound that with the number of new coaches and systems in the NFL in 2011 and guys like Sammy Morris will be more valuable than the stud Tailback from Auburn.]]></description>
